Do we need eye creams?

The short answer is… yes. Yes, we do need eye creams, but why?
The skin around our eyes is the thinnest and the most delicate as compared to other parts of our body, making our eyes the most susceptible to signs of ageing.
Eye creams are therefore recommended for all.
Eye creams can help with reducing the appearance of dark circles, fine lines, crepiness, puffiness and swelling, but can also help with reducing signs of ageing like wrinkle formation around the eyes, especially when the product has anti-ageing properties to help in this aspect.
When your eyes are strained or when you have a lack of sleep, blood may pool around your under eyes - creating what we more commonly refer to as dark eye circles.
You may also be experiencing eye bags and swelling, which might give the illusion of dark eye circles due to its shadow cast.
